A member asked:

What will cause the heart to have angeoplasty or cathorization?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Cardiac disease: A cardiologist will perform an angiogram if blockage of a coronary artery is suspected based upon symptoms, changes on ecg, and elevated cardiac enzymes in the blood. If a blockage is found the angioplasty dilates the blocked artery and a stent is placed in that area.
